A codec (coder-decoder) is the software algorithm used to compress and decompress digital video. For over a decade, H

Codecs are the compression technologies used to shrink video files.

The preferred choice for high-quality rips. It can support an unlimited number of video, audio, and subtitle tracks (including lossless audio and soft subtitles) inside a single file.

This is the modern successor to H.264, often labeled in file names as or HEVC .

In many regions, creating a digital backup ("rip") of a movie you legally own (e.g., a Blu-ray disc) for personal, private use is often considered legal, though this varies significantly by jurisdiction.

Before dedicating storage space or time to a movie file, you can check its actual technical specifications using free media tools like or via the properties tab in advanced media players like VLC or MPC-HC .

This is the highest quality you can get. It takes the original audio and video streams from a Blu-ray and puts them into a new container (like MKV) without any re-encoding.
